Reports are out claiming that Zinedine Zidane’s future with Real Madrid is under a sudden dark cloud.
Zidane’s Castilla team have opened the season winning their first three games, but there is tension at management level.
TMW claims that Zizou and some directors entered a robust discussion recently with many wounds left open.
A new meeting has been scheduled in attempt to ease the tension, but if Zidane is left dissatisfied he could walk out on the club.
Former agent Marc Roger spoke recently to L’Equipe about Zidane and his relationship with Real president Florentino Perez.
“Pérez, he always wants to be the star. He dismissed Raul, Casillas … Why has he not called Zidane as Real coach? He fears that he will put him in the shade. Who’s (Rafa) Benitez? Zidane should be the coach, he will not be patient for two or three more years. He (Perez) had the opportunity to appoint him. But he always wants to be the star.”
